Monthly Cost of Living

A single person spends $1,138 per month in Mangalia vs $1,378 in Ubud, Bali, rent included.

A couple spends around $1,722 per month in Mangalia vs $2,327 in Ubud, Bali, rent included.

A family of three spends $2,306 per month in Mangalia vs $3,275 in Ubud, Bali, rent included.

Mangalia is about 17% cheaper than Ubud, Bali, driven mainly by Eating Out.

Cost Breakdown

A central one-bedroom costs $400 in Mangalia versus $1,114 in Ubud, Bali. Rent is usually the largest line item in a monthly budget, so the gap here sets the tone for the overall comparison.

Salaries run about 357% higher in Mangalia, which reinforces the cost advantage – you earn more and spend less. Purchasing power leans clearly in its favor.

A mid-range dinner for two costs $49.00 in Mangalia versus $36.00 in Ubud, Bali. Groceries tell a different story – $212 in Mangalia vs $294 in Ubud, Bali – so Mangalia wins on supermarket bills even if dining out costs more.
